Bumps @astrojs/mdx from 2.3.1 to 3.0.0.

Release notes

Sourced from @​astrojs/mdx's releases.

@​astrojs/mdx@​3.0.0

Major Changes

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Refactors the MDX transformation to rely only on the unified pipeline. Babel and esbuild transformations are removed, which should result in faster build times. The refactor requires using Astro v4.8.0 but no other changes are necessary.

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Allows integrations after the MDX integration to update markdown.remarkPlugins and markdown.rehypePlugins, and have the plugins work in MDX too.

    If your integration relies on Astro's previous behavior that prevents integrations from adding remark/rehype plugins for MDX, you will now need to configure @astrojs/mdx with extendMarkdownConfig: false and explicitly specify any remarkPlugins and rehypePlugins options instead.

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Renames the optimize.customComponentNames option to optimize.ignoreElementNames to better reflect its usecase. Its behaviour is not changed and should continue to work as before.

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Replaces the internal remark-images-to-component plugin with rehype-images-to-component to let users use additional rehype plugins for images

Patch Changes

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Simplifies plain MDX components as hast element nodes to further improve HTML string inlining for the optimize option

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Allows Vite plugins to transform .mdx files before the MDX plugin transforms it

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Updates the optimize option to group static sibling nodes as a <Fragment />. This reduces the number of AST nodes and simplifies runtime rendering of MDX pages.

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Tags the MDX component export for quicker component checks while rendering

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Fixes export const components keys detection for the optimize option

  • #10935 ddd8e49 Thanks @​bluwy! - Improves optimize handling for MDX components with attributes and inline MDX components
